PROBLEM

Big Brothers Big Sisters of Connecticut (BBBSCT) needed help leveraging paid digital advertising to increase the number of male volunteers (leads) for their Bigs community-based program. They were actively engaging their audience organically but they were not seeing a proportional increase in volunteers. While they could track the total volume of leads through their backend CRM, they did not have capabilities to properly attribute where the leads were coming from.

SOLUTION &SERVICES

Regan Communications Group was tasked to come up with a cost-effective solution to both bring new volunteers through Meta and Google advertising and configure marketing technology to properly attribute our lead generating efforts. Having worked with another Big Brothers Big Sisters chapter, we were in a unique position to consult and quickly solve the lack of visibility. 

 

Within less than a week of creative approval, our team launched the first campaigns leveraging the learnings from our previous experience. The results started to show up almost instantaneously. Not only were they experiencing a big jump on the volunteer application volume, a significant percentage were highly qualified. In fact, after 5 short months, we had to scale down to help BBBSCT’s lead nurturing team catch up!

RESULTS

Big Brothers Big Sisters of Connecticut was able to achieve their fiscal year volunteer goals. Regan helped produce almost 500 leads on about $30,000 in ad spend within one year. The cost per lead averaged to $60 which was far below what they were expecting.  As a bonus, their social media following more than doubled and their organic reach almost tripled in the same reporting period.
